About the role

We’re seeking a passionate Operations Coordinator to join Larita Academy, playing a crucial role in transforming young lives through operational excellence. Reporting to the CSR Operations Manager, you’ll be the backbone of our youth development program, ensuring smooth delivery whilst maintaining a supportive and inclusive environment for our participants.

What You’ll Do

Program Administration and Coordination
 

  • Lead the operational delivery of Larita Academy, EmPath, and Alumni program
  • Manage program calendars, stakeholder relationships, and compliance requirements
  • Maintain database systems and drive continuous improvement initiatives
  • Coordinate social media presence and marketing communications

Event & Operations

  • Coordinate training sessions, academies, and meetings
  • Manage logistics including venue arrangements, catering, and materials
  • Oversee volunteer engagement and merchandise distribution
  • Support scholarship program administration

Strategic Support

  • Assist Senior Leadership team with high-level administrative support
  • Generate program impact reports and analytics
  • Identify and escalate risks and issues as needed
  • Contribute to maintaining safe and inclusive environments for at-risk youth

What You’ll Bring

  • Experience in NFP, Social Enterprise, Community Services, or CSR organisations (preferred)
  • Strong interpersonal and stakeholder engagement skills
  • Excellent written and verbal communication abilities
  • Proven track record in operational support within fast-growing environments
  • Strong organisational and administrative skills, including governance and data management
  • Background in working with at-risk youth (preferred but not essential)
  • Passion for purpose-driven work and creating inclusive environments
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ite
  • Valid driver’s licence
  • Working With Children Check (or willingness to obtain)
